    The Terminal Operator is responsible for safely operating all Terminal equipment in connection with receiving, storing, transferring, and loading of liquid bulk products via trucks, pipeline, rail cars, water vessels or tanks. The Terminal Operator is also responsible for the testing of products and documentation of results; maintenance of Terminal equipment; preparation of various Terminal reports; and general maintenance and upkeep of the facility. This position is a safety-sensitive position. Job Duties and Responsibilities Ensure the safe operation of the terminal; maintain awareness for personal and co-workers safety, and ensure knowledge and compliance with all policies and procedures. Perform gauging of storage tanks, temperature readouts, and obtaining product samples. Perform all daily, monthly, quarterly, semi-annual, and annual maintenance and compliance inspections, and maintain required logs as appropriate. Complete daily meter readings for all products. Calculate and input all product inventories and meter readings into appropriate systems. Ensure that all Terminal equipment, including safety devices and systems are functioning properly, and report any and all equipment failures to supervisor. Perform daily walk around inspections to identify any potential risks and ensure good housekeeping standards are maintained at all times. Conduct preventive and routine maintenance on various operating equipment, including, but not limited to, pumps, valves, meters, compressors, motors, tanks, pipes, terminal building, and various other equipment. Calibrate and adjust all additive injection systems as required. Basic testing of oils, such as viscosity, A.P.I. and flash when necessary. About the Organization: TransMontaigne Partners LLC is a terminaling and transportation company based in Denver, Colorado with operations in the United States on the Pacific Coast, the Gulf Coast, in the Midwest, and in the Southeast. We provide integrated terminaling, storage, transportation and related services for customers engaged in the distribution and marketing of light refined petroleum products, heavy refined petroleum products, crude oil, chemicals, fertilizers and other liquid products. Light refined products include gasolines, diesel fuels, heating oil and jet fuels; heavy refined products include residual fuel oils and asphalt. How much does a logistics operator earn in Moore, OK?

The average logistics operator in Moore, OK earns between $27,000 and $40,000 annually. This compares to the national average logistics operator range of $30,000 to $46,000.
